How can I dynamically update the HTML page content using JavaScript without having to reload the entire page?

1 Answers
Answered by suresh

To dynamically update the HTML page content using JavaScript without having to reload the entire page, you can utilize the DOM manipulation methods available in JavaScript. One common approach is to target specific elements on the page and update their content programmatically.

Here is an example code snippet demonstrating how this can be achieved using JavaScript:

```html

Dynamic Content Update

Initial Content

Initial text content

function updateContent() {
document.getElementById("heading").innerHTML = "New Heading";
document.getElementById("content").innerHTML = "New text content";
}

```

In this example, we have a heading and a paragraph element whose content can be updated dynamically when the button is clicked. The `updateContent` function uses `getElementById` to target the elements by their IDs and then updates their `innerHTML` property with the new content.

By using this method of manipulating the DOM, you can update specific parts of the HTML page content without the need to reload the entire page, providing a more seamless and interactive user experience.

This approach is not only user-friendly but also helps improve the overall performance and SEO of the web page by reducing unnecessary page reloads.

Answer for Question: How can I dynamically update the HTML page content using JavaScript without having to reload the entire page?